Oliver O. Howard Carte de Visite Signed "O.O. Howard Maj. Gen." 2.5" x 4", with an M.B. Brady & Co. imprint, along with a blue George Washington two-cent tax stamp on the verso. A vignette bust of Oliver Otis Howard, signed at bottom. The card is captioned as being "Entered according to Act of Congress by M.B. Brady & Co. in the year 1865 in the Clerk's Office of the District Court of the District of Columbia." Howard (1830-1909), known as "The Christian General" for his piety, saw action at First Bull Run, Fair Oaks (for which he was awarded the Congressional Medal of Honor), Antietam, Gettysburg, Chancellorsville, and Sherman's March to the Sea and the Carolinas. He commanded the Army of Tennessee and after the war helped found Howard University in Washington, D.C. From the Bret J. Formichi American Civil War Rarities Collection. Condition: Minor soiling at the upper right corner, else very good.
